Abstract

The invention relates to a vacuum film pasting mechanism, which comprises a base, a matching body, a negative pressure structure and a rolling pressing structure, wherein the base is provided with anaccommodating groove; the matching body is movably arranged on the base; the matching body is provided with a matching groove; the matching groove and the accommodating groove jointly form a film pasting cavity; a pressing flexible belt is arranged in the matching groove; the negative pressure structure comprises a vacuum generator and a plurality of vacuum connecting pipes; the plurality of vacuum connecting pipes are arranged on the vacuum generator and are communicated with the film pasting cavity; the rolling and pressing structure comprises a driving element and a rolling pressing shaft;the driving element is arranged on the matching body; the rolling and pressing shaft is arranged on the top of the pressing flexible belt and is connected with the driving element. The vacuum film pasting mechanism cannot easily generate bubbles; and the efficiency is high.

technical field [0001] The invention relates to a vacuum film sticking mechanism. Background technique [0002] With the development of the communication industry, more and more people use mobile phones. During the use of the mobile phone, it is easy to cause pits such as indentations on the surface of the mobile phone, thereby affecting the use. Therefore, the mobile phone needs to be pre-coated before use. However, the mobile phone film sticking operation generally needs to be carried out manually, so that the surface of the mobile phone is prone to air bubbles, and the efficiency is low. Contents of the invention [0003] Based on this, it is necessary to provide a vacuum film sticking mechanism that is less likely to generate air bubbles and has higher efficiency.
